GREETERS/USHERS
· As a Greeter you, (with your spouse and family) can cheerfully welcome those who gather at the SEMC each Sunday.
· As Ushers you (and your family) will cheerfully welcome those attend our church service, distribute bulletins, collect the offering, assist people as needed.
· In both roles you will serve once every 6 or 7 weeks.
KITCHEN TEAM
Our Kitchen team serves together in the preparation of meals for specific church-wide events throughout the year (5 or 6 times). They also take turns providing coffee and cookies once a month on a Sunday morning.
Please contact the church office (sarniaemc@cogeco.net) if you are interested in these roles.
COMPUTER OPERATOR (youth and adult)
Serving once a month on Sunday mornings this position will require operating the music slides and videos required. You need to be present at 9:15am to coordinate with the rest of the Sunday team. Training is provided.
YOUTH LEADERS
We are looking for a few adults willing to invest in, mentor and have fun with our IMPACT students. We are looking for those willing to make a weekly commitment of 2 hours on either Wednesday (Jr. High) or Friday evenings (Highschool).
